Pistol Sustainment

Shooting is a perishable skill - you use it or you lose it.

This class presents some new drills to keep you self-proficient.

We will also demonstrate the effect of different pistol caliber bullets on materials such as drywall, concrete block and others.  Check out the video of our last demonstration on our Facebook Page.

Length:1 day class
Time:10:00am - 5:00pm
Type:Hands-On Training
Audience:Everyone
Prerequisites:Pistol 101 or equivalent

Topics Covered:

Brief review of Combat Pistol Basics
Ballistic properties of various materials
Advanced shooting drills
Training concepts designed to maintain and improve your proficiency

What to Bring:Pistol, Approximately 500 rounds of ammo, Weather appropriate clothing, Pants with belt, 3 Magazines, Holster, Eye and Hearing Protection, Double Pistol Mag Pouch, Tactical light / weapon light
